General Description
Hotts Hill Forest is a recently planted high production woodland in South Scotland on the edge of Eskdale Muir, one of Scotland's largest productive forest areas and with easy access to a range of sawmills, timber processors and biomass power plants.

The woodland was planted in 2019 with support from Scottish Forestry's Forestry Grant Scheme, a copy of which can be supplied on request. The wood has been well maintained and has high stocking density of most species and tree types and is considered by vendor to meet the grant contract obligations.

The woodland composition is described in table 1 below.

Table 1 woodland composition (as per FGS contract)
Species Area % Yield Class
Sitka spruce 41.10 71.9% 20
Norway spruce 5.54 9.6% 12
Scots pine 1.89 3.3% <8
Mixed broadleaves 2.90 5.1% <4
Open space 5.71 10.1%
Grant aided area 57.14 100.0%
Wayleaves and other open space 10.19
Total 67.33


Purchasers are advised to make their own assessment on stocking density, but drone imagery of the crops is available on request to support this assessment.

The Forestry Research on-line tool, Ecological Site Classification estimates that Sitka spruce at Hotts Hill Forest is likely to achieve a yield class of about 20m3/ha/yr. and Norway spruce 12 m3/ha/yr. These two crops will provide most of the future timber production and Forestry Commission yield models for unthinned crops indicate that Sitka spruce will produce about 684m3 / ha and Norway spruce 327 m3 / ha in 40 years.

Grant Schemes and Conditions
The woodland was established under the Forestry Grant Scheme contact reference number 17FGS21797-001
dated 12-02-2018. The grants comprised of capital and annual payments totalling £199,933.80 and it is understood these have all been claimed and paid in full. A copy of the contract is available on request.

Purchasers should be aware that they will be required to sign and agree to take on the contract and all binding obligations for the full duration of the contract which is for 20 years from the receipt of the first grant payment.

Access
Access to the woodland is from the M74 via the B725 to Waterbeck and from there Northeast for 2km on the B722. These roads are classed as "consultation routes" via the Timber Transport Forum and these are defined as: Recognised as key to timber extraction but which are not up to Agreed Route standard. Consultation with Local Authority is required, and it may be necessary to agree limits of timing, allowable tonnage etc. before the route can be used. These are typical of many minor roads throughout Scotland, and these are unlikely to impose any significant restrictions.

Access to the woodland from the B722 is via a good farm track to the river. Establishment and maintenance operations to date have been completed by fording the river but future timber extraction will require the construction of a bridge at this point and new sections of forest road into the wood.

The wood adjoins an unclassified public road at the north. This is unsuitable for future timber access and is classified as an excluded route.

The maintenance of the farm road (A-B on the map) will be agreed based on use and form part of the contract. The double gates off the public road can be replaced and / or new gates set back 30m to allow timber lorries unimpeded access off the public road.
